CC -!- FUNCTION: Catalyzes the sequential condensation of isopentenyl CC pyrophosphate with the allylic pyrophosphates, dimethylallyl CC pyrophosphate, and then with the resultant geranylpyrophosphate to CC the ultimate product farnesyl pyrophosphate. CC -!- CATALYTIC ACTIVITY: Dimethylallyl diphosphate + isopentenyl CC diphosphate = diphosphate + geranyl diphosphate. CC -!- CATALYTIC ACTIVITY: Geranyl diphosphate + isopentenyl diphosphate CC = diphosphate + trans,trans-farnesyl diphosphate. CC -!- PATHWAY: Isoprenoid biosynthesis; farnesyl-PP biosynthesis; CC farnesyl-PP from geranyl-PP and isopentenyl-PP: step 1/1. CC -!- PATHWAY: Isoprenoid biosynthesis; geranyl-PP biosynthesis; CC geranyl-PP from dimethylallyl-PP and isopentenyl-PP: step 1/1. CC -!- SUBCELLULAR LOCATION: Cytoplasm. Note=Rubber particles. CC -!- SIMILARITY: Belongs to the FPP/GGPP synthetase family.
